Milo Blast from Jollibee


For only Php37 a cup, this Milo Blast, part of Jollibee's Sundae Mix-Ins is a great way to beat the heat this summer. This vanilla ice cream mixed with crushed cookies and the much familiar milo cereal balls and milo powder is a great way to bond with family or friends during a hot and humid afternoon.

Battling the Heat Wave with Blizzardly Goodness from DQ

The temperatures are up again in the Philippines and it feels like the heat of summer sun rises a bit early these days (I can't believe I'm sweating at like 6 in the morning!). While my usual morning breakfast of hot coffee is officially out for the meantime and cold water and fruit juices are in, it's also nice to get some chill time strolling the air-conditioned malls while enjoying a gooey cold treat at hand, like the Strawberry Oreo Blizzard from DQ.

It was my first time to try the flavor after a hearty lunch at Shakey's together with my brothers. In celebration of Oreo's 100th Anniversary, DQ launched 10 new Oreo-inspired flavors for Oreo lovers like me - Caramel marshmallows, Chocolate Oreo, Chocolate Truffle, Double Dutch , Mocha Kitkat, Mocha Oreo, Strawberry Kitkat, Strawberry Oreo, Ube Macapuno and White Truffle.

Smart tip to avoid ice cream drippings

SMART TIP: How to avoid ice cream drippings?

We can’t help it! Come on, admit it, it doesn’t just happen on kids. We, sometimes have this sloppy tendency to stain our much loved dress with some mean ice cream drippings. Uhm, chocolate ice cream anyone? :) Bad day right?

So what are we going to do about it? Here’s a great idea I found from a magazine – the solution to our dip-free cones. To keep ice cream from dripping from the bottom of the cone, drop some mini marshmallows before scooping in the cold treat and viola! Genius, right?! It doesn’t just prevent that unwanted drippings, it’s also a yummy welcome surprise at the end of your total ice cream experience!
